The Saint John Paul the Great Catholic Wolves''s rec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Saturday after their seventh straight loss. They took a serious blow against Archbishop Carroll, falling 37-6. Saint John Paul the Great Catholic was in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at 27-6.
TK Davis was on fire for Archbishop Carroll: he rushed for 210 yards and three touchdowns on only ten carries. Davis' longest rush was for an incredible 70 yards. The team also got some help courtesy of Gabriel Amadi, who rushed for 56 yards and a touchdown.
Saint John Paul the Great Catholic's defeat was their fifth straight at home, which dropped their overall record down to 1-9. That rough patch could be blamed on the team's offensive performance across that stretch, as they only averaged 8.4 points per game. As for Archbishop Carroll, they have been performing well recently as they've won four of their last five contests, which provided a massive bump to their 5-4 record this season.
